Lee Westwood leads in Thailand
Lee Westwood shot a 12-under-par 60 - the best round of his career - to establish a five-shot lead on day one of the Thailand Golf Championship.
The Englishman carded 10 birdies and an eagle at the Amata Spring Country Club.
"I made a dream start and you start thinking about 59, I guess," said Westwood, the world number three.
